Nike Dunk High Ambush Shoes: A Closer Look
The Nike Dunk High Ambush is perhaps the most recognizable model from the collaboration. The high-top silhouette, combined with Ambush's signature design touches, results in a statement shoe. The sizing for these shoes, however, requires careful consideration. Many users report that the fit can be slightly snug, especially around the ankle and heel. This is largely due to the construction and the materials used. The premium leather often provides a more structured feel, which can feel tighter than other, more flexible materials.
Nike Dunk High Ambush Black: A Popular Choice
The Nike Dunk High Ambush Black is a particularly popular colorway. Its sleek, monochromatic design makes it incredibly versatile, easily pairing with a wide range of outfits. However, the sizing concerns remain consistent across colorways. While some find the standard Nike Dunk sizing accurate for this model, many others report needing to go half a size up for a more comfortable fit. This is especially true if you have wider feet or prefer a looser fit.

Nike Dunk Ambush Flash Lime: A Vibrant Option
The Nike Dunk Ambush Flash Lime offers a striking contrast to the understated elegance of the black colorway. Its bright, vibrant color makes it a head-turner. While the design elements remain consistent with other Ambush Dunks, the sizing considerations are also similar. Again, many users recommend going half a size up, especially if you intend to wear thicker socks.
